Impact of In-Person and Mobile Exercise Coaching on Psychosocial Factors Affecting Exercise Adherence in Inactive Women With Obesity: 20-Week Randomized Controlled Trial.

Abstract

backgroundRegular exercise may counteract obesity-related health risks, but adherence is low among individuals with obesity. Personal trainers may positively influence exercise behavior by providing motivational support. Individuals who receive regular exercise coaching are more likely to adhere to their exercise routine, compared with those who exercise individually. However, investing in personalized exercise guidance, such as a personal trainer, can be expensive for the individual. Thus, integrating web-based coaching could be a more economically sustainable option, offering both flexibility and reduced costs compared with in-person coaching only. Yet, research is needed to assess the effect of hybrid models in improving psychosocial factors among women with obesity.

objectiveThis 20-week, pragmatic randomized controlled trial aimed to investigate the effect of weekly in-person coaching compared with 2 combinations of in-person and web-based coaching on 5 psychosocial factors in women with obesity (BMI ≥30 kg/m

methodsParticipants were invited through Facebook and Instagram advertisements posted by various fitness clubs across rural and urban locations in Norway (7 different counties and 12 different municipalities). Women with low activity (n=188; <150 minutes of moderate-intensity physical activity/week; 42.7, SD 10.5 years; mean BMI of 35.1, SD 6.9 kg/m

resultsA total of 120 (64%) out of 188 participants completed baseline and postintervention assessments. A minor difference was observed in one item of the SF-36, where all intervention groups reported a greater "change in health last year" than the control group (mean difference: 14.2-17.1, 95% CI 2.04-29.5; g=0.79-1.14; P≤.01). No other effects were found on the selected psychosocial factors. It should be noted that controls reported higher intrinsic motivational regulation at baseline than intervention groups (mean difference: 0.43-0.93; P≤.05). All intervention arms exercised more frequently than controls (mean difference: 1.1-1.5; P≤.001), with no differences in weekly exercise frequency between the 3 intervention arms (P=.30).

conclusionsWe found no effects on motivation, barriers, self-efficacy, perceived social support, or other health domains compared with controls. All intervention groups reported a slight improvement in self-perceived health in 1 of the 8 subscales of the SF-36. Combined in-person and web-based coaching may give a minor improvement in self-perceived health in women with obesity. However, the lack of impact on motivation, barriers, and self-efficacy warrants further research.
